Understanding Picture Hook Nail Guns
Picture hook nail guns are a specialized type of nail gun designed for a single purpose: hanging pictures and other lightweight items on walls. They are also known as "picture hangers." These tools are straightforward and easy to use, making them a popular choice for both homeowners and professional installers.
Key Technical Details
-
Operation: Picture hook nail guns typically operate manually. Users press the gun against the wall and squeeze the trigger to drive a nail or hook into the wall.
-
Nail Types: These nail guns use small, thin-gauge nails, often with a hook or loop attached to them, to hold the picture wire or cord securely.
-
Power Source: Picture hook nail guns do not require an external power source, making them highly portable and easy to use in various locations.
-
Safety Features: While these tools are simple, some models may include safety features such as a nail depth adjustment to prevent damage to the wall.
Using a Picture Hook Nail Gun
Using a picture hook nail gun is a straightforward process:
-
Select the Right Hook: Choose a hook or nail that suits the weight and hanging requirements of your picture or item.
-
Position the Hook: Determine the ideal placement for your picture hook on the wall and mark it with a pencil.
-
Load the Hook: Insert the hook or nail into the nail gun’s firing chamber.
-
Align and Fire: Place the nail gun on the marked spot, ensuring it’s level. Squeeze the trigger to drive the hook into the wall.
-
Hang Your Picture: Once the hook is securely in place, hang your picture or item on it.
